Who We Are

The San Mateo Public Library is part of the Peninsula Library System and the Main Library is conveniently located near downtown San Mateo’s stores and restaurants. It provides access to tens of thousands of books, DVDs, and CDs in a wide range of languages; free high-speed internet and wi-fi; numerous community meeting rooms; study areas; unique play and learning spaces for teens and children; and cultural events, as well as art exhibits, throughout the year.

The Hillsdale and Marina branches also provide neighborhood access to popular books, movies, and music; high speed wi-fi and internet access; and ongoing children’s programs.

Example of volunteer opportunities include:

  • Computer Aide
  • Welcome Greeter
  • Storytime Assistant
  • Friends of the Library
  • Discard Support
  • Job Seekers Assistant
  • Project Read Tutor
  • Cultural Advisory Committees
  • Cleaning Wizards
  • Teen Task Assistant
